定制vendor_aosp配置,打造个性化CSS解决方案

需积分: 31 2 下载量 113 浏览量 更新于2024-12-23 收藏 37.74MB ZIP 举报
资源摘要信息:"vendor_aosp:定制配置" 在Android操作系统开发领域,"vendor_aosp"通常指代与Android Open Source Project(AOSP)相关的供应商定制配置。AOSP是谷歌主导的开源项目,旨在提供Android操作系统的源代码。然而,为了适应不同硬件和特定需求,各设备制造商(即“供应商”)往往需要对AOSP进行定制。 1. 定制配置的含义与重要性: - 定制配置指的是根据特定硬件特性、用户需求或是厂商的独特需求对AOSP进行修改和优化的过程。 - 这种定制是Android设备制造商参与AOSP开发的一个重要环节,以确保他们的设备能在操作系统层面上正常运行,并且能够发挥硬件的最大潜能。 - 定制配置涵盖了系统级别的调整,比如内核优化、驱动程序集成、特定硬件功能的实现、性能优化、安全性加强等。 2. 定制配置的方法与步骤: - 获取AOSP源代码:设备制造商首先需要从Android官方网站下载对应的AOSP源代码。 - 创建或应用设备特定的配置:这通常包括设备树(Device Tree)的创建和修改,设备树是一个包含硬件配置信息的文件集合。 - 编译和适配:设备制造商需要编译AOSP源代码,并进行多次测试以确保所有定制的功能能够正确工作。 - 运行和测试:在定制配置完成后,设备制造商会在硬件上运行系统,并进行详尽的测试来确保稳定性、兼容性和性能。 3. CSS在定制配置中的角色: - 在这个上下文中提到的“CSS”可能是一个错误,因为CSS(层叠样式表)主要用在Web开发中,用于描述HTML或XML文档的呈现。 - 可能是由于上下文错误,应该指的是类似XML或JSON配置文件,它们在Android系统中广泛用于定义系统配置、资源和界面。 - 如果确实是在讨论AOSP的定制配置,那么CSS可能是一个误用的标签。 4. 关于压缩包子文件(vendor_aosp-eleven): - 这里提到的“压缩包子文件”应该是指包含了定制配置的压缩包。 - 这个压缩包可能包含了所有必要的文件和目录,以便设备制造商能够在自己的硬件平台上应用定制配置。 - "vendor_aosp-eleven"这个名称暗示了这是针对特定版本或特定设备的定制配置文件包,其中"eleven"可能是版本号或者是一个特定的代号。 综上所述,"vendor_aosp:定制配置"是一个涉及到设备制造商对Android系统进行深度定制的过程,需要对源代码进行修改和适配,以确保与特定硬件的兼容性和优化。这种定制通常是封闭源代码的,且受到知识产权保护。而在实际操作中,设备制造商需要密切关注AOSP的更新,以便及时整合最新的源代码更改,并确保其设备得到最佳的支持和维护。